Overview
- The locomotive derailed at 03:35 local time on the Kiziterinka–Protochny section in Rostov-on-Don.
- Approximately 20 long-distance services and five suburban trains were delayed for up to four hours.
- No injuries were reported, according to the North Caucasus Railway branch of Russian Railways.
- Train movement was redirected to an adjacent track while restoration work continued at the scene.
- The Southern Transport Prosecutor's Office opened a check with Deputy Rostov transport prosecutor Yaroslav Vuychich on site as causes and circumstances are established.
